The Allure of Anime Love Stories

Anime love stories come in many forms—romantic dramas, comedies, tragedies, and even fantasy adventures. Their popularity stems from the way they create deep emotional connections with viewers, allowing them to experience relationships in ways that are often exaggerated or idealized. At the core of many anime love stories is the portrayal of idealized love. These stories often depict love as a transformative force that conquers all obstacles, a theme that resonates deeply with audiences who yearn for emotional fulfillment.

One of the reasons why anime love stories are so compelling is the artful way in which characters are developed. Whether they are high school students navigating the complexities of their first crush or powerful beings from different worlds who must overcome great odds to be together, anime characters are often relatable, multidimensional, and incredibly endearing. The emotions displayed in these stories—hope, heartache, joy, longing—mirror real-life experiences, making it easy for viewers to project their own desires and struggles onto the characters.

The Emotional Impact of Anime Love Stories

Watching anime love stories creates a strong emotional bond with the characters and their romantic journeys. These narratives often take viewers on a roller coaster of emotions, from the excitement of falling in love to the heartbreak of separation. This emotional journey has a long-lasting effect on viewers, as they invest not only their time but also their emotions in the outcome of the story.

The emotional impact is intensified by the often dramatic storytelling techniques employed in anime. The use of music, stunning visuals, and poignant dialogue heightens the experience, making the viewer feel as though they are part of the love story. This immersive experience allows anime lovers to momentarily escape from their own lives and enter a world where love is all-encompassing and powerful.

In some cases, the emotional weight of these stories can be overwhelming. Viewers who connect deeply with the characters may feel genuine sadness, joy, or frustration when a relationship faces challenges or when the story takes an unexpected turn. This deep emotional engagement can sometimes result in long-term effects, influencing how viewers approach love and relationships in their own lives.

The Cultural Influence of Anime Love Stories

Anime has long been a reflection of Japanese culture, and love stories in anime often showcase ideals rooted in that culture. In Japanese society, themes of duty, honor, and sacrifice are often explored, which can be seen in the way love stories unfold. The idea of selflessness in relationships—whether in familial, romantic, or platonic contexts—is a central theme in many anime love stories.

For Western audiences, anime love stories offer a unique cultural perspective on love and relationships. The narrative styles, character archetypes, and emotional depth of these stories often differ significantly from those found in traditional Western romance films or literature. As a result, anime love stories introduce viewers to different views of love, relationships, and societal expectations. They encourage open-mindedness and empathy, as viewers learn about cultural nuances and alternative ways of expressing affection.

This cultural exchange can be particularly meaningful for fans who feel disconnected from traditional love stories portrayed in mainstream media. Anime love stories often explore relationships in ways that challenge stereotypical portrayals of romance, offering more diverse and inclusive perspectives. They provide an opportunity to see relationships from various angles, whether it’s an unexpected love between individuals from different worlds or a romantic journey that transcends time and space.
